The Isle of Wight Council plans to establish a joint venture company with private firms to develop the Solent Ocean Energy Centre (SOEC) project, according to the Isle of Wight County Press.

The Council cabinet will make a decision on the establishment of the joint venture company next week and the partners from the private sector will be familiar after the agreement is signed.

This means that the private companies would invest GBP 1 million in the project , adding to the Council’s GBP 1 million and GBP 700,000 of European funding.

The SOEC testing / demonstration facility to develop tidal energy technology will produce 20MW of energy and could lead to the creation of a full scale tidal energy production centre also off St Catherine’s that would be capable of generating 200-250 MW of green power (enough to power 136,000 homes).
